Vice President Jim has a subordinate, Eric, who is dating his daughter, and the two have developed a serious relationship. When it comes time to recommend Eric for a salary increase, Jim will be facing a conflict of interest.

Conflict Of Interest

Judgment or objectivity is compromised because of two competing ends that must be satisfied.

Salary Increase

An upward adjustment in wages or earnings, often reflecting recognition of employee performance, inflation, or changes in market rates.

Subordinate

An individual who is under the authority or control of another within an organizational hierarchy.
